Job Summary
Lead Emergency Veterinarian responsible for owning and guiding clinical excellence, mentoring doctors, coaching to grow careers, and ensuring a customer-centered, efficient ER workflow per VEG’s standards (VEG Spikes). Key duties include direct patient care in emergencies, triage, diagnostic and therapeutic planning, communicating options to customers, maintaining medical records, leading monthly doctor meetings, developing growth plans for fellow doctors, and supporting the Medical Director with coverage and scheduling. May involve interim MD duties, training program ownership for NERD, and participating in scheduling with advanced notice. Requires DVM/VMD or equivalent, ER experience, and leadership aptitude; availability for nights, weekends, and holidays; ability to work in a fast-paced, high-noise environment. Emphasis on mentorship, coaching, and hospital-level leadership to foster career growth and clinical excellence.
Required Qualifications
- DVM, VMD, or equivalent degree
- 2+ years of ER experience and critical case management
- One year leadership experience is preferred, but not required
- Training in emergency surgery/endoscopy
